/* Subcommands for tcl "get" command */
#include <stdio.h>
#include <ctype.h>
#include <tcl.h>
#include "tcl_browse.h"

int getCmds();
int getResponse();
int getKey();
int getKeyname();
int getLine();
int getEnv();
int getFile();
int getError();
int getMode();
int getCwd();

struct subcmd getcmds[] = {
        { getCmds, "commands", 0, 0, "" },
        { getResponse, "response", 0, 3, "[prompt [default [term]]]" },
        { getKey, "key", 0, 1, "[prompt]" },
        { getKeyname, "keyname", 1, 1, "key" },
        { getLine, "line", 1, 1, "{home,last,end,*,.}" },
        { getFile, "file", 1, 1, "{file,*,.}" },
        { getEnv, "env", 1, 1, "name" },
        { getError, "error", 0, 0, "" },
        { getMode, "mode", 0, 0, "" },
        { getCwd, "cwd", 0, 0, "" },
};
int getcnt = sizeof getcmds / sizeof *getcmds;

int
cmdGet(clientData, interp, argc, argv)
ClientData clientData;
Tcl_Interp *interp;
int argc;
char **argv;
{
        return Handle(getcnt, getcmds, interp, argc, argv);
}

getCmds(interp, argc, argv)
Tcl_Interp *interp;
int argc;
char **argv;
{
        return Format(getcnt, getcmds, interp);
}

char *StrToList(s)
char *s;
{
        char *argv[2];
        argv[0] = s;
        argv[1] = 0;
        return Tcl_Merge(1, argv);
}

getEnv(interp, argc, argv)
Tcl_Interp *interp;
int argc;
char **argv;
{
        char *getenv();
        char *s = getenv(*argv);
        if(!s)
                Tcl_Return(interp, NULL, TCL_STATIC);
        else
                Tcl_Return(interp, s, TCL_STATIC);
        return TCL_OK;
}

getKeyname(interp, argc, argv)
Tcl_Interp *interp;
int argc;
char **argv;
{
        char *name_of();
        strcpy(interp->result, name_of(**argv));
        return TCL_OK;
}

getCwd(interp, argc, argv)
Tcl_Interp *interp;
int argc;
char **argv;
{
        extern char *dot;
        strcpy(interp->result, dot);
        return TCL_OK;
}

extern int getFile(interp, argc, argv)
Tcl_Interp *interp;
int argc;
char **argv;
{
        extern char *file_name();
        extern int curr;

        if(strcmp(*argv, ".") == 0) {
                Tcl_Return(interp, StrToList(file_name(curr)), TCL_DYNAMIC);
        } else if(strcmp(*argv, "*") == 0) {
                extern int nentries;
                char **argv = (char **)ckalloc(sizeof (char *) * nentries);
                int argc = 0;
                int i;

                for(i = 0; i < nentries; i++) {
                        if(tagged(i))
                                argv[argc++] = file_name(i);
                }
                argv[argc] = 0;
                if(argv)
                        Tcl_Return(interp, Tcl_Merge(argc, argv), TCL_DYNAMIC);
                else
                        Tcl_Return(interp, NULL, TCL_STATIC);
                ckfree(argv);
        } else if(isdigit(**argv)) {
                Tcl_Return(interp,
                        StrToList(file_name(atoi(*argv))),
                        TCL_DYNAMIC);
        } else {
                sprintf(interp->result, "bad line number:  should be \"get file {line,*,.}\"");
                return TCL_ERROR;
        }
        return TCL_OK;
}

getResponse(interp, argc, argv)
Tcl_Interp *interp;
int argc;
char **argv;
{
        char buffer[256];
        char *def = "";
        char term = 0;
        extern int display_up;

        if(argc >= 1 && argv[0][0]) {
                cmdline();
                outs(argv[0]);
        } if(argc >= 2)
                def = argv[1];
        if(argc >= 3)
                term = argv[2][0];
        if(inps(buffer, def, term) == '\033') {
                Tcl_Return(interp, "Command Killed", TCL_STATIC);
                return TCL_ERROR;
        } else {
                Tcl_Return(interp, buffer, TCL_VOLATILE);
                if(display_up == 0)
                        outc('\n');
                return TCL_OK;
        }
}

getLine(interp, argc, argv)
Tcl_Interp *interp;
int argc;
char **argv;
{
        int line;

        extern int curr;
        extern int top;
        extern int nlines;
        extern int nentries;

        if(strcmp(*argv, "home") == 0) line = top;
        else if(strcmp(*argv, "last") == 0) line = top+nlines-1;
        else if(strcmp(*argv, "end") == 0) line = nentries-1;
        else if(strcmp(*argv, ".") == 0) line = curr;
        else if(strcmp(*argv, "*") == 0) {
                extern int nentries;
                char *string = (char *)ckalloc(8 * nentries);
                char *p = string;
                int i;

                for(i = 0; i < nentries; i++) {
                        if(tagged(i)) {
                                sprintf(p, "%d ", i);
                                p += strlen(p) - 1;
                        }
                }
                if(p > string) {
                        *--p = 0;
                        Tcl_Return(interp, string, TCL_DYNAMIC);
                } else {
                        ckfree(string);
                        Tcl_Return(interp, NULL, TCL_STATIC);
                }
        } else {
                sprintf(interp->result,
                        "invalid line type: should be \"get line {home,last,end,*,.}\"");
                return TCL_ERROR;
        }

        sprintf(interp->result, "%d", line);
        return TCL_OK;
}

getKey(interp, argc, argv)
Tcl_Interp *interp;
int argc;
char **argv;
{
        extern int display_up;

        if(*argv) {
                cmdline();
                outs(*argv);
        }
        interp->result[0] = getch();
        interp->result[1] = 0;
        if(*argv && !display_up)
                outc('\n');
        return TCL_OK;
}

static char *last_errmsg = "No Error";
static char *last_errfile = NULL;
static char filename[BUFSIZ];

save_errmsg(s)
char *s;
{
        last_errfile = 0;
        last_errmsg = s;
}

save_errno(file)
char *file;
{
        extern char *strerror();
        extern int errno;
        last_errmsg = strerror(errno);
        last_errfile = filename;
        strncpy(filename, file, BUFSIZ);
}

getError(interp, argc, argv)
Tcl_Interp *interp;
int argc;
char **argv;
{
        static char buffer[BUFSIZ];

        if(last_errfile)
                sprintf(buffer, "%s: %s", last_errfile, last_errmsg);
        else
                strcpy(buffer, last_errmsg);
        Tcl_Return(interp, buffer, TCL_VOLATILE);
        return TCL_OK;
}

getMode(interp, argc, argv)
Tcl_Interp *interp;
int argc;
char **argv;
{
        extern int display_up;
        extern int quickmode;
        char buffer[32];

        if(quickmode)
                strcpy(buffer, "narrow");
        else
                strcpy(buffer, "wide");
        if(display_up)
                strcat(buffer, " page");
        else
                strcat(buffer, " line");
        Tcl_Return(interp, buffer, TCL_VOLATILE);
        return TCL_OK;
}
